MUS 431

Fall 2007 All Classes

All Classes

Credit: 2 hours.

Objectives, techniques, literature, and materials for teaching piano to children from about ages five through ten (elementary level); observation of lessons and supervised student teaching experience.

Required of applied piano majors. Prerequisite: Senior standing in music or music education, or consent of instructor.
